WP Maintenance Project maintains a WordPress maintenance plugin that, despite narrow scope, addresses a commonly managed administrative function across WordPress deployments, creating an input-handling surface exposed to both site administrators and web-based interfaces. The recurring vulnerability signal centers on cross-site scripting and cross-site request forgery issues, reflecting typical risks in WordPress plugin input validation and state-management patterns. CVE-2019-19979HIGH A flaw in the WordPress plugin, WP Maintenance before 5.0.6, allowed attackers to enable a vulnerable site's maintenance mode and inject malicious code affecting site visitors. The | Dec 26, 2019 | 8.8 | 26 | NO | NO |
CVE-2021-36828MEDIUM Authenticated (admin+) Stored Cross-Site Scripting (XSS) in WP Maintenance plugin <= 6.0.7 versions. | Apr 15, 2022 | 4.8 | 19 | NO | NO |
CVE-2022-30536MEDIUM Authenticated Stored Cross-Site Scripting (XSS) vulnerability in Florent Maillefaud's WP Maintenance plugin <= 6.0.7 at WordPress. | Jul 21, 2022 | 4.8 | 15 | NO | NO |
